Squamous Cell Carcinoma (SCC):
-2nd most common form of skin cancer
-Shape varies
-More likely to develop on skin often exposed to sun
i.e. - face, ears, lips, backs of hands, arms, legs
-Can develop on regions of body not exposed to sun
*i.e. - inside mouth, genitalia
-Smoking and chewing tobacco can increase risks
-If untreated for a long amount of time, it can spread and make treatment difficult
